Congratulations to the 2021 winners of the Walter Roberts Public Diplomacy Studies award!
By Yvonne Oh, IPDGC Program Coordinator The Walter Roberts Endowment and the Institute for Public Diplomacy and Global Communication (IPDGC) are proud to announce that Global Communication graduates Saiansha Panangipalli and Halea Kerr-Layton are the joint recipients of the Walter Roberts Award for Public Diplomacy Studies for 2021.
